Resumo: | Aeronautical field demands, even more, costs optimization and reducing related to components production subjected to static and dynamic loading, and exposed to hostile environments. Ti-6Al-4V alloy is used in this area due to its mechanical properties. The main objective of this research is to analyze Ti-6Al-4V alloy fatigue behavior subjected to shot peening and PIII. First, the samples have been superficially treated by shot peening followed by nitrogen implantation via PIII. For the fatigue behavior study, axial fatigue tests were carried out. In order to complement the research, microstructural analysis were made in samples with and without treatment using X-ray diffraction, optical microscopy, scanning electron microscopy and microhardness measurements. Samples treated by shot peening obtained higher values of fatigue resistance and roughness compared to the other conditions (without treatment, treated by PIII, treated by SP + PIII). Therefore, it was concluded that, considering fatigue behavior, the compressive residual stresses induced by the shot peening treatment had a greater impact than roughness increase. In the case of samples submitted to the combined treatment of SP + PIII, the results of fatigue resistance obtained were lower than the results of the untreated condition, indicating that the temperature which the samples were submitted during the PIII treatment have damaged its fatigue performance |

A liga Ti-6Al-4V vem sendo utilizada nesse setor em virtude das suas propriedades mecânicas apropriadas para esse tipo de aplicação. O principal objetivo deste trabalho é o estudo do comportamento em fadiga da liga Ti-6Al-4V submetida aos tratamentos superficiais de shot peening e 3IP. Primeiramente, as amostras foram submetidas ao tratamento superficial de shot peening e, posteriormente ao tratamento de implantação de nitrogênio por 3IP. Para a análise do comportamento em fadiga, foram realizados ensaios de fadiga axial. De modo a complementar o trabalho, foram feitas análises microestruturais das amostras com e sem tratamento utilizando-se as técnicas de difração de raios X, microscopia óptica, microscopia eletrônica de varredura e medidas de microdureza. As amostras tratadas por shot peening obtiveram maiores valores de resistência à fadiga e rugosidade em comparação às demais condições (sem tratamento, tratada por 3IP, tratada por SP + 3IP). Portanto, conclui-se que, em relação ao comportamento em fadiga do material, as tensões residuais de natureza compressiva induzidas pelo tratamento de shot peening tiveram maior impacto do que o aumento da rugosidade.
